Abstract

Aimed at the problem that the current composite pulse multipath channel estimation methods for impulse radio-ultra wideband (IR-UWB) system can't solve the effect of pulse waveform distortion caused by ISI, a composite pulse multipath channel estimation method based on nearest neighbor (NN) rule was proposed. This estimated composite pulse multipath channel was subsequently used as a template in a correlator-based detector, and then the detection performance of template obtained by proposed method and conventional averaged method was compared in simulation. Simulation results show that when there is no ISI, the NN estimation method achieves similar BER performance as average method, when ISI is caused by overlap of symbols, the BER performance of NN estimation significantly outperforms that of the average method.
